Changelog for racket-7.8-43.1.x86_64.rpm :

* Fri Aug 21 2020 infoAATTpaolostivanin.com- Update to 7.8:
* Racket CS supports AArch32 and AArch64, including places and futures.
* Racket CS supports an \"incremental\" garbage-collection mode that can eliminate long GC pauses for some applications, such as animations and interactive games.
* Racket CS unboxes local floating-point arithmetic
* DrRacket\'s spell check features lower overhead and has fewer bugs.
* Web Server performance under high concurrency is better by up to an order of magnitude
* The math library includes the Kronecker product.
* The new prop:struct-field-info property provides static information about field names.
* In `plot`, the legend font and the plot font can be controlled independently, and error-bars have an `#:invert?` option.
* Racket CS uses a new HAMT implementation, dramatically reducing the memory required for immutable hash tables.
* GC callbacks are reliably called on major collections in Racket CS. Also, Garbage collection is 10-20% faster.
* DrRacket can recover much more quickly from errors involving large stack traces.
* Call-with-current-language allows more reliable tests for language level code.
* Use of the Cairo library can be multi-threaded.
* DrRacket\'s scrolling has been made more responsive.
* DrRacket\'s dark mode support is improved for Mac OS and Unix.
* The Web Server provides fine-grained control over various aspects of handling client connections (timeouts, buffer sizes, maximum header counts, etc.) via the new \"safety limits\" construct.
* The Web Server\'s handling of large files is improved, and its latency for long-running request handlers is reduced.

* Tue Jul 16 2019 jbrielmaierAATTsuse.de- Update to 7.3:
* There is a new set of teaching languages for the upcoming German-language textbook \"Schreibe Dein Programm!\"
* Racket\'s IO system has been refactored to improve performance and simplify internal design.
* Racket\'s JSON reader is dramatically faster.
* The `plot` library includes color map support for renderers.
* The Racket web library has improved support for 307 redirects.
* The Racket web server provides better response messages by default for common status codes.
* The `pict` library includes a `shear` function.- remove patches:

* Wed Mar 27 2019 wernerAATTsuse.de- Require some missed libraries and certificates for build as well as for installation even if rmplint cries- Update to racket 7.2
* The contract system supports collapsible contracts, which avoid repeated wrappers in certain pathological situations. Thanks to Daniel Feltey.
* Quickscript, a scripting tool for DrRacket, has become part of the standard distribution. Thanks to Laurent Orseau.
* The web server\'s built-in configuration for serving static files recognizes the \".mjs\" extension for JavaScript modules.
* The `data/enumerate` library supports an additional form of subtraction via `but-not/e`, following Yorgey and Foner\'s ICFP\'18 paper. Thanks to Max New.
* The `letrec.rkt` example model in Redex has been changed to more closely match Racket, which led to some bug fixes in Racket\'s implementation of `letrec` and `set!`.
* The racklog library has seen a number of improvements, including fixes to logic variable binding, logic variables containing predicates being applicable, and the introduction of an `%andmap` higher-order predicate.
